It’s here. It’s time. Apple ProRes is hitting the iPhone 13 Pro and Pro Max right now! 422 HQ to be exact. 6 gigabytes be minute to be even more exact. But what does that even mean and how would you even use it?
Alex Linsday joins me - The man who knows as much about ProRes as anyone outside Apple, and who you may know from ILM and Queen Amidala’s ship, or streaming pretty much every major event in big tech - to talk all about it!

@babyhammurabi on my 512gb I can record about 85min of 4K ProRes422 HQ in filmic pro. Dropping down to 422 and 422LT that number goes up to about 120mins and 150mins respectively. That’s a decent amount of storage space for one or two shoots, depending on the kind of work you’re doing.
